28.  Where a provision continues to apply by virtue of this Part, it is to be read as if—

(a)in section 36(1) of the 1989 Act—

(i)there were inserted at the appropriate place—

enforceable EU right” means a right recognised and available in domestic law, immediately before [F1IP completion day], by virtue of section 2(1) of the European Communities Act 1972;;

(ii)in the definition of “exempt person”, for paragraphs (a) to (c) there were substituted—

(a)a person who, immediately before [F2IP completion day], was a national of a relevant European State,

(b)a person who, immediately before [F2IP completion day], was a national of the United Kingdom and, at that time, was seeking access to, or pursuing, the profession by virtue of an enforceable EU right, or

(c)a person who, immediately before [F2IP completion day], was not a national of a relevant European State, but at that time was, by virtue of an enforceable EU right, entitled to be treated, for the purposes of access to and pursuit of the profession, no less favourably than a national of a relevant European State;;

(iii)in the definition of “General Systems Regulations” [F3(other than in that definition as it is saved by paragraph 25A)], at the end there were inserted—

(a)in relation to anything done before [F4IP completion day], as they had effect at that time;

(b)otherwise, as (and only to the extent that) they have effect, on or after [F4IP completion day], in relation to an entitlement which arose before [F4IP completion day] or arises as a result of something done before [F4IP completion day];;

(b)in any reference to a relevant European State other than the United Kingdom, the words “other than the United Kingdom” were omitted.
